Opto-Thermal Design and Analysis of a 1 MW Panel Solar Central Receiver for Small-Scale Applications

This paper discusses the design and analysis of a panel receiver for the solar tower, with the objective of designing a suitable receiver for a small-scale solar tower plant. The plant is intended to have a high temperature (> 450 °C) thermal power output of 1 MW to be used for charging thermal storage for various applications like backup for a thermal power plant or metallurgical applications like heat treatment. The heat flux distribution on the panel receiver has been obtained using a radial staggered heliostat field with centre of the receiver as aiming point. This design and analysis of the panel receiver has been done for Bikaner, India on spring equinox, solar noon. The thermal efficiency of this designed receiver comes out to be 79.5%.
